These dynamic filaments, in conjunction with myosin, play a crucial role in generating forces essential for cellular contraction and fundamental cell movement. This network of protein fibers is known as the cytoskeleton. Of the three types of protein fibers in the cytoskeleton, microfilaments are the narrowest. Microfilaments, also called actin filaments, are polymers of the protein actin that are part of a cell’s cytoskeleton.
